In today's fast-paced globe, the original 9-5 time-table no further applies to many people. Aided by the rise of dual-income families and non-traditional work hours, the need for 24-hour daycare solutions was ste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are centers provide moms and dads the flexibility they have to balance work and family members obligations, and offer a safe and nurturing environment for children 24 / 7.

Benefits of 24-Hour Daycare:

Among the crucial great things about 24-hour daycare may be the mobility it provides working parents. Numerous moms and dads work shifts that extend beyond conventional daycare hours, making it difficult to find childcare that suits their routine. 24-hour daycare centers solve this issue by providing treatment during nights, vacations, and also in a single day. This allows moms and dads to operate without fretting about finding anyone to view their children during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are is the satisfaction it offers to parents. Comprehending that their children are being cared for by trained experts in a safe and secure environment can alleviate the stress and shame that often comes with leaving children in daycare. Parents can give attention to their work understanding that their children have been in good hands, that may induce increased efficiency and work satisfaction.

Furthermore, 24-hour daycare facilities provides a feeling of neighborhood and help for people. Parents whom work non-traditional hours frequently struggle to get a hold of childcare options that meet their needs, resulting in feelings of separation and stress. 24-hour daycare centers could offer a feeling of that belong and camaraderie among moms and dads facing comparable difficulties, generating a support network which will help people thrive.

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ers offer many benefits, they also incorporate unique pair of challenges. One of the biggest challenges is staffing. Finding competent and reliable childcare providers that happy to work non-traditional hours could be tough, resulting in high turnover prices and possible staffing shortages. This can impact the caliber of attention supplied to kids and create instability for households relying on 24-hour daycare services.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are may be the expense. Providing attention night and day needs additional staffing and sources, which can drive up the cost of services. This can be a barrier for low-income people which may not be in a position to pay for 24-hour daycare, making all of them with restricted alternatives for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

To be able to make sure the security and wellbeing of young ones in 24-hour daycare centers, regulation and supervision are necessary. State and neighborhood governing bodies set standards for licensing and accreditation of daycare facilities, including those that operate round the clock. These standards cover an array of areas, including staff-to-child ratios, safe practices requirements, and staff instruction and skills.

And federal government regulations, numerous 24-hour daycare centers elect to seek certification from nationwide companies including the nationwide Association for the knowledge of young kids (NAEYC) or perhaps the nationwide Association for Family Child Care (NAFCC). Accreditation shows dedication to top-notch attention and will assist moms and dads feel confident in their selection of childcare supplier.
